The Importance Of Emergency Phones In Ensuring Safety And Security

In today’s fast-paced world, having access to emergency phones can highly contribute to ensuring safety and security in various environments. emergency phones, also known as security phones or help points, are strategically placed communication devices that allow individuals to quickly call for help in case of emergencies. These phones serve as a lifeline in situations where immediate assistance is needed, such as during accidents, medical emergencies, or criminal activities.

One of the key benefits of emergency phones is their ability to provide a direct line of communication to emergency services, security personnel, or designated responders. In situations where time is of the essence, being able to quickly reach out for help can make all the difference in ensuring a positive outcome. emergency phones are often equipped with features such as one-touch dialing, speakerphones, and bright LED lights to make them easily accessible and visible, even in low-light conditions.

emergency phones are commonly found in a variety of public spaces, including college campuses, parking lots, shopping malls, parks, and parking garages. These phones serve as a deterrent to potential criminals, as they provide a visible indication that help is readily available in case of an emergency. The presence of emergency phones can instill a sense of security and peace of mind among individuals, knowing that help is just a phone call away.

In addition to providing a direct line of communication to emergency services, emergency phones also offer several other important benefits. For instance, emergency phones can be equipped with features such as video cameras, motion sensors, and emergency buttons to enhance security and provide real-time monitoring of the surrounding area. These additional features can help deter crime, facilitate faster response times from law enforcement, and ensure that first responders have all the information they need to act quickly and effectively.

Emergency phones are also designed to withstand harsh weather conditions and physical abuse, ensuring that they remain operational even in the most challenging environments. Many emergency phones are built using durable materials such as stainless steel and fiberglass, and are equipped with tamper-resistant features to prevent vandalism and misuse. This robust construction helps to ensure that emergency phones are always ready to provide assistance when needed, regardless of external factors.

Another important aspect of emergency phones is their ability to provide two-way communication between the caller and the responder. This direct line of communication allows emergency services to assess the situation, provide instructions to the caller, and coordinate a response in real-time. In situations where the caller may be injured, confused, or unable to speak, emergency phones can help responders quickly determine the nature of the emergency and dispatch the appropriate resources to the scene.

In recent years, the rise of mobile technology has raised questions about the relevance and necessity of emergency phones. While many individuals now carry smartphones with them at all times, there are several key advantages that emergency phones offer over mobile devices in emergency situations. Emergency phones are standalone devices that are dedicated solely to providing emergency assistance, unlike smartphones that may be out of battery, out of range, or subject to network congestion during emergencies. Emergency phones also offer a highly visible and easily accessible point of contact for individuals who may not have access to a mobile device or who may be in need of immediate assistance.
